Abstract

Carbohydrate loading, or glycogen supercompensation, is a specialized dietary strategy employed by endurance athletes to maximize glycogen stores in skeletal muscle and liver, thereby enhancing performance in prolonged high-intensity activities exceeding 90 minutes. This process involves a strategic reduction in exercise combined with an increased carbohydrate intake, leading to an elevated capacity for glucose utilization. While scientifically validated for its target demographic, the generalized adoption of "carb loading" by the sedentary population or individuals engaged in low-to-moderate intensity exercise represents a significant nutritional misapplication. This leads to chronic caloric surplus, contributing to weight gain, metabolic dysregulation, and a distorted understanding of balanced nutrition. Our team at NutriSnap has spent years peeling back the layers of this nutritional onion, dissecting where good science went terribly, terribly wrong. The original scientists, back in the 1960s—guys like Bergström and Saltin—they were brilliant. They discovered that by depleting muscle glycogen (your body's stored sugar) through intense exercise and then drastically increasing carbohydrate intake for a few days, you could actually super-compensate. You could store more glycogen than usual. This was a game-changer for marathoners and ultra-endurance athletes. But they weren't talking about your brunch bagel, were they? No. They were talking about a grueling 7-day protocol, often involving a biopsy to confirm the results. This wasn't a casual affair; it was a hardcore, scientific intervention for elite performance.

Let's break down the actual science, super simple. Your body stores sugar as "glycogen." Think of it as a piggy bank for energy. When you exercise hard and long, you spend that money. If you spend all of it, and then you start putting extra money in your piggy bank, your body says, "Whoa, I better make this bank bigger, just in case!" That's supercompensation. But if you're not spending all the money in your piggy bank—if you're just spending a little here and there—and you keep stuffing more and more in, what happens? The bank overflows. And where does that overflow go? Your body is smart, but it's also a storage expert. It converts that extra sugar, that extra energy, into fat. Plain and simple. It's the slow, steady creep of the spare tire. It’s the inexplicable weight gain despite "eating healthy." It's the pre-diabetes diagnosis that sneaks up on you. This isn’t rocket science; it’s just basic energy balance, thrown completely out of whack by a misinterpreted concept.
